#48eb95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#48eb95 is composed of 28.2% red, 92.2%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.6%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 148.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 60.2%. #48eb95 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#00d72b.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#48eb95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#48eb95 has RGB values of R:72, G:235,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 4778901.

Shades and Tints of #48eb95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c06 is the darkest color, while #f9fefb is the lightest one.
